Definition and Overview

Candesartán cilexetil is an orally administered prodrug that gets converted into its active form during metabolism. It selectively inhibits the angiotensin II receptors, thus blocking the effects of a hormone known for causing blood vessels to constrict. By blocking these receptors, candesartán facilitates vasodilation, leading to reduced blood pressure levels. This makes it an important option for treating hypertension, particularly in patients who may not tolerate other antihypertensive medications.

Interaction with Angiotensin

Candesartán Cilexetil belongs to the angiotensin II receptor blocker (ARB) class of medications. Its primary function is to hinder the action of angiotensin II, a peptide that significantly contributes to blood pressure elevation. Angiotensin II causes blood vessels to constrict, leading to increased vascular resistance and higher blood pressure.

When Candesartán Cilexetil binds to angiotensin II receptors, particularly the AT1 receptor subtype, it effectively prevents angiotensin II from exerting its vasoconstrictive effects. This interaction is crucial for managing hypertension since it directly diminishes peripheral vascular resistance.

Additionally, by obstructing the receptor, Candesartán Cilexetil can positively influence renal function. The reduction in blood pressure alleviates load on the heart and kidneys, which is beneficial in patients with heart failure or certain kidney diseases.

Common Side Effects

Common side effects of Candesartán Cilexetil are mostly manageable but may still affect patient compliance and overall treatment satisfaction. Some frequently reported side effects include:

  • Dizziness: This usually occurs due to lowered blood pressure, particularly after the initial doses.
  • Headache: This can also arise as a side effect of changes in blood pressure.
  • Fatigue: Some patients experience fatigue, which might be attributed to blood pressure lowering effects.
  • Nausea: Gastrointestinal discomfort may occur in some patients.

These side effects largely depend on dosage and individual variability. They often subside as the body acclimates to the medication. Monitoring patient responses during the early phases of treatment is necessary to manage these concerns effectively.

Severe Reactions and Risks

While serious adverse effects are rare with Candesartán Cilexetil, healthcare professionals must remain vigilant. Severe reactions can include:

  • Hypotension: Extreme drops in blood pressure can occur, leading to fainting or falls, especially if the medication is combined with diuretics.
  • Renal Dysfunction: Candesartán can impact kidney function, particularly in patients with pre-existing renal impairment or those taking other nephrotoxic drugs.
  • Allergic Reactions: Though uncommon, signs like swelling, rash, or difficulty breathing necessitate immediate medical attention.

Co-administration with Other Medications

Candesartán cilexetil may be co-administered with various drugs for different medical conditions. However, potential interactions must be carefully considered. For example, when used alongside diuretics like hydrochlorothiazide, the combined effect can enhance blood pressure reduction. This dual therapy can provide better management for patients with resistant hypertension.

Certain medications, including non-steroidal anti-inflammatory drugs (NSAIDs) and some antidiabetic drugs, can lead to decreased effectiveness of candesartán. This reduction happens due to a mechanism that affects the renin-angiotensin system. Healthcare providers should monitor these combinations closely. Patients must be educated on which drugs may pose a risk when used in tandem with candesartán cilexetil.

It is also vital to be cautious when prescribing candesartán with lithium, as levels of lithium may rise, leading to toxicity. Regular blood monitoring is recommended in such cases to ensure safety and efficacy.

Impact on Renal Function

The kidneys play a pivotal role in regulating blood pressure and fluid balance. Candesartán cilexetil, as an angiotensin II receptor blocker, affects renal function in multiple ways. One major action is the reduction of glomerular pressure. By blocking the constrictive effects of angiotensin II on the renal vasculature, the drug can lead to protection against nephropathy in some patients.

  • Improved Renal Perfusion: This medication aids in enhancing blood flow to the kidneys, which can be particularly beneficial for patients with chronic conditions.
  • Reduction in Proteinuria: Studies suggest that candesartán cilexetil may help lessen protein leakage in urine, a sign of early kidney damage.
  • Overall Renal Function: Several clinical trials indicate that it can stabilize renal function in hypertensive patients and those with heart failure.

Use in Patients with Kidney Disease

In patients with a history of kidney disease, the administration of candesartán cilexetil requires careful assessment. The benefits it provides can be significant, but close monitoring is necessary to prevent potential adverse outcomes. It is essential to account for factors such as the stage of kidney disease and the presence of other comorbidities.

  • Dosing Adjustments: In patients with renal impairment, doses may need modifications. This ensures effective management of blood pressure without overwhelming the compromised renal systems.
  • Monitoring Criteria: Regular evaluation of serum creatinine and electrolytes should accompany treatment. This helps detect any deterioration in kidney function swiftly.
  • Preventing Progression of Disease: Candesartán cilexetil can slow the progression of kidney disease among patients with diabetes-related nephropathy or hypertension, which underscores its therapeutic role in this population.

While the potential benefits are clear, careful management and individualized treatment plans are crucial for success when using candesartán cilexetil in patients with kidney disease.
